What is Digital Marketing?

Digital marketing is the practice of promoting products, services, or brands using digital channels and technologies. Digital marketers employ various strategies to engage with their target audience, increase brand visibility, and drive conversions. Some common responsibilities of a digital marketer include:

  • Developing and implementing digital marketing campaigns
  • Conducting market research and analyzing consumer behavior
  • Creating and optimizing content for websites and social media platforms
  • Managing online advertising campaigns
  • Monitoring and analyzing data to measure the effectiveness of marketing strategies
  • Collaborating with cross-functional teams to achieve marketing goals

Where does a Digital Marketing work?

Digital marketers can work in a wide range of industries, including e-commerce, technology, advertising agencies, and even non-profit organizations. Many digital marketers also work as freelancers or consultants, providing their expertise to multiple clients. With the rise of remote work opportunities, digital marketers can work from anywhere with a reliable internet connection.

What are the requirements to become a Digital Marketing in North Carolina?

To become a digital marketer in North Carolina, you will need a combination of education, skills, and experience. While there is no specific degree required, having a bach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or a related field can be advantageous. Additionally, acquiring relevant certifications can demonstrate your expertise and enhance your job prospects.

In North Carolina, there are no legal requirements or licenses specifically for digital marketers. However, it is essential to stay updated with the latest laws and regulations related to digital marketing, such as data privacy and advertising guidelines.

Professional certifications

In addition to online courses, there are also professional certifications available for digital marketing. These certifications are often offered by industry organizations and can be a valuable addition to your resume.

Here are a few examples of professional certifications in digital marketing:

  1. Google Ads Certification: This certification demonstrates your proficiency in Google Ads and is recognized by employers worldwide. To earn this certification, you'll need to pass the Google Ads Fundamentals exam, as well as one or more additional exams in specialized areas like search advertising, display advertising, or video advertising.

  2. Facebook Blueprint Certification: This certification is offered by Facebook and demonstrates your expertise in Facebook advertising. To earn this certification, you'll need to pass the Facebook Certified Planning Professional exam or the Facebook Certified Buying Professional exam.

  3. Hootsuite Social Marketing Certification: This certification is offered by Hootsuite and is designed for social media marketers. To earn this certification, you'll need to pass a comprehensive exam that tests your knowledge of social media marketing strategies and best practices.

North Carolina Digital Marketing course options

If you're specifically looking for digital marketing courses or certifications in North Carolina, there are several options available to you. Many universities and colleges in the state offer digital marketing programs, both at the undergraduate and graduate levels. These programs often include courses in digital marketing strategy, social media marketing, SEO, content marketing, and more.

Here are a few examples of universities in North Carolina that offer digital marketing programs:

  1. University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ill: The University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ill offers a Professional Certificate in Digital Marketing. This program is designed for working professionals and covers topics such as digital strategy, social media marketing, content marketing, and analytics.

  2. North Carolina State University: North Carolina State University offers a Master of Science in Marketing with a concentration in digital marketing. This program is designed for individuals who want to pursue a career in digital marketing and covers topics such as marketing analytics, social media marketing, and online advertising.

  3. Wake Technical Community College: Wake Technical Community College offers a Digital Marketing Certificate program. This program is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of digital marketing strategies and techniques, including SEO, social media marketing, content marketing, and more.

How do I get a job as a Digital Marketer?

Once you've obtained your digital marketing certification, the next step is to find a job in the field. Here are some steps you can take to increase your chances of landing a job as a digital marketer:

Build a strong portfolio

One of the best ways to showcase your skills and experience to potential employers is by building a strong portfolio. This can include examples of your work, such as websites you've optimized for search engines, social media campaigns you've managed, or content marketing pieces you've created.

If you're just starting out and don't have any professional experience, consider taking on freelance projects or internships to gain hands-on experience and build your portfolio. You can also create your own projects, such as a personal blog or social media profiles, to demonstrate your expertise and creativity.

Network

Networking is a crucial part of finding a job in any field, and digital marketing is no exception. Attend industry conferences, join professional organizations, and connect with other digital marketers on social media platforms like LinkedIn. Building relationships with professionals in the industry can lead to job opportunities and valuable mentorship.

Stay up to date with industry trends

Digital marketing is a constantly evolving field, with new tools, techniques, and trends emerging all the time. It's important to stay up to date with these changes and continually expand your knowledge and skills. Subscribe to industry newsletters, follow digital marketing blogs and influencers, and participate in online forums and communities to stay informed about the latest developments in the field.

Tailor your resume and cover letter

When applying for digital marketing jobs, it's important to tailor your resume and cover letter to each specific position. Highlight relevant skills and experience, such as your expertise in social media marketing or your proficiency in Google Analytics. Be sure to include any certifications or professional memberships you have obtained.

Prepare for interviews

Before going into an interview, research the company and familiarize yourself with its digital marketing strategies and goals. Be prepared to discuss your experience and how it aligns with the company's needs. Practice answering common interview questions, and come prepared with examples of your work and the results you have achieved in previous digital marketing roles.

Career Paths and Opportunities after Becoming a Digital Marketer

Once you've become a digital marketer, there are several career paths and opportunities available to you. Here are a few examples:

Digital Marketing Specialist

As a digital marketing specialist, you'll work on a specific area of digital marketing, such as SEO, social media marketing, or content marketing. You'll be responsible for developing and implementing strategies to drive traffic and engagement, as well as analyzing data and optimizing campaigns for better results.

Digital Marketing Manager

As a digital marketing manager, you'll oversee the overall digital marketing strategy for a company or organization. You'll be responsible for managing a team of digital marketers, as well as developing and implementing strategies to achieve the company's marketing goals. You'll also be involved in budgeting, setting targets, and measuring the success of digital marketing campaigns.

E-commerce Manager

As an e-commerce manager, you'll be responsible for managing the online sales and marketing efforts of a company. You'll work closely with the digital marketing team to develop and implement strategies to drive online sales, optimize the user experience, and increase customer retention. You'll also be responsible for managing e-commerce platforms and analyzing data to identify opportunities for growth.

Digital Marketing Consultant

As a digital marketing consultant, you'll work independently or for a consulting firm, providing strategic advice and guidance to clients on their digital marketing efforts. You'll conduct audits, develop strategies, and provide recommendations to help clients achieve their marketing goals. This role requires a deep understanding of digital marketing best practices and the ability to adapt strategies to different industries and target audiences.
